Game Info
Date | May 22, 1906 |
---|---|
Day of Week | Tue |
Day / Night | D |
Visiting Team | Boston Braves |
Home Team | Pittsburgh Pirates |
Visiting Starting Pitcher | Gus Dorner |
Home Starting Pitcher | Sam Leever |
Ballpark | Exposition Park |
City | Pittsburgh |
State | PA |
Attendance | 5,650 |
Time of Game | 1 hour 35 minutes |
Umpires | HP: Jim Johnstone 1B: (none) 2B: (none) 3B: (none) |
Boston Braves Lineup
Name | Position |
---|---|
Al Bridwell | Shortstop |
Fred Tenney | First Baseman |
Cozy Dolan | Right Fielder |
Del Howard | Left Fielder |
Dave Brain | Third Baseman |
Johnny Bates | Center Fielder |
Allie Strobel | Second Baseman |
Tom Needham | Catcher |
Gus Dorner | Pitcher |
Fred Tenney | Manager |
Pittsburgh Pirates Lineup
Name | Position |
---|---|
Dutch Meier | Left Fielder |
Bob Ganley | Right Fielder |
Tommy Leach | Center Fielder |
Honus Wagner | Shortstop |
Joe Nealon | First Baseman |
Claude Ritchey | Second Baseman |
Tommy Sheehan | Third Baseman |
George Gibson | Catcher |
Sam Leever | Pitcher |
Fred Clarke | Manager |
